Started by serial entrepreneur Hernus Carelsen, Strategic Founders emerged from a simple yet powerful realisation.
After building and scaling multiple businesses, Hernus experienced firsthand the unique challenges that come with growing a company from 20 to 200 employees. It's a phase where traditional startup advice no longer applies, yet corporate playbooks feel disconnected from reality.
The frustration was real—well-meaning advice from employees who'd never faced founder-level decisions, corporate executives removed from the grind of building something from scratch, and endless opinions from those who'd never actually built a business themselves.
What was missing? A space where founders/owners could speak candidly with peers who truly understood. People who'd lived through the same sleepless nights, made similar tough calls, and navigated the grey areas that don't appear in any business book.
Strategic Founders is that space—a close-knit, invitation-only Sydney community where like-minded entrepreneurs gather for honest, unfiltered conversations.
We meet 9 times a year in early morning sessions lasting 2 hours, usually at Cliftons in Sydney CBD. No pitches, no agendas—just real founders/owners sharing real experiences, challenges, and breakthroughs with people who get it.
